The Passion of the Christ: Songs is an album of songs inspired by the 2004 film The Passion of the Christ. It was produced by Mark Joseph and Tim Cook and executive produced by Mel Gibson. It won the 2005 GMA Music Award for Special Event Album of the Year.[2]

Awards[]

In 2005, the album won a Dove Award for Special Event Album of the Year at the 36th GMA Dove Awards.[3]
